Japanese man's traditional black silk haori jacket with hand painted landscape motif (H-142 ), Vintage, 1960's

HAORI is mid-length loose jacket that serve as a coat to be worn over a kimono. Haori are traditional Japanese clothes which were worn by men as a component of the formal attire. All kimono jackets are hand sewn and "one of a kind". Haori can be used as a garment or an unique interior decor to brighten up the corner of your home.
That is black formal heavy silk haori jacket with five samurai family Takanoha mon or crest and with bluish gray silk lining artistically hand painted and partly gilded. You can see romantic mountain's landscape with golden mist rising on,  fishing boat, small bridge and houses among pine trees.. Japanese poem is writing on the haori lining.
